1. What Are Electricity Suppliers?

Electricity suppliers are companies that generate and sell electrical power to consumers and businesses. They play a crucial role in ensuring that electricity is delivered consistently and reliably to end-users. The functions of electricity suppliers can be categorized into several key areas:

  • Generation: The creation of electricity from various energy sources, including renewable energy (solar, wind, hydro) and non-renewable sources (coal, natural gas).
  • Transmission: The transportation of electricity over long distances through high-voltage power lines.
  • Distribution: The final delivery of electricity to homes and businesses, often involving lower-voltage power lines.
  • Customer Service: Managing customer accounts, billing, and providing support to consumers.

2. The Importance of Reliable Electricity Supply

A reliable electricity supply is essential for modern life. It powers our homes, businesses, and industries. Interruptions in power supply can lead to significant economic losses, affect safety, and disrupt daily activities. Therefore, electricity suppliers must ensure efficient operations to minimize outages and maintain customer satisfaction.

6. Future Trends in the Energy Sector

The energy sector is continuously evolving, influenced by technological advancements and changing consumer demands. Some trends to watch include:

  • Decentralized Energy Production: Increased adoption of local renewable energy sources means consumers can produce their own power.
  • Smart Homes: Home automation systems are becoming more common, allowing individuals to manage their energy consumption easily.
  • Integration with Electric Vehicles: As EV adoption rises, the need for charging infrastructure integrated with electricity supply networks will become critical.
